Join Our Business Intelligence Team as a Software Engineer
Bloomreach is seeking a talented Software Engineer to join our Business Intelligence team. This role is perfect for someone passionate about data-driven insights and AI technologies. You will work on cutting-edge technologies, impacting millions of users, and contributing to a product that truly makes a difference.
What You'll Do
- Design & Deliver New Features: Translate business requirements into technical specifications, focusing on backend logic and data processing. Design and implement secure and efficient APIs for data access and manipulation.
- Integrate AI Capabilities: Explore and implement GenAI or LLM models as backend services, providing data processing and insights generation capabilities.
- Collaborate with Teams: Work closely with product designers, front-end engineers, data scientists, and product managers to ensure seamless integration of business intelligence features.
- Ensure Quality and Performance: Write comprehensive unit tests and integration tests, implement robust logging and monitoring, and collaborate with QA engineers.
- Support and Maintain Components: Respond to client inquiries, troubleshoot issues, implement bug fixes, and document code and processes.
Technologies and Tools
- Programming Languages: Python
- Cloud Services: Google Cloud Platform, GKE, BigQuery
- Data Storage and Processing: MongoDB
- Software and Tools: Grafana, Sentry, Gitlab, Jira, Productboard, PagerDuty
Your Success Story
- In 30 Days: Successfully onboard and contribute to ongoing tasks.
- In 90 Days: Contribute to design discussions and deliver high-quality code.
- In 180 Days: Manage larger tasks and handle L3 support confidently.
Experience and Qualities
- Professional: Proven experience in Python engineering, system design, and maintenance of analytical features.
- Personal: Strong initiative, excellent communication skills, and a commitment to continuous learning.
Why Bloomreach?
- Culture: Enjoy a great deal of freedom and trust, flexible working hours, and a remote-first environment.
- Personal Development: Access to a communication coach and a professional education budget.
- Well-being: Employee Assistance Program, subscription to Calm app, and DisConnect days.
- Compensation: Restricted Stock Units or Stock Options, company performance bonus, and employee referral bonus.
Join us and transform the future of commerce experiences with Bloomreach!
Benefits Extracted with AI
- Flexible working hours
- Remote-first work environment
- Company events
- Volunteer days
- Professional education budget
- Employee Assistance Program
- Subscription to Calm app
- DisConnect days
- Sports, yoga, and meditation opportunities
- Extended parental leave
- Restricted Stock Units or Stock Options
- Company performance bonus
- Employee referral bonus
Similar jobs
Last update: 23 minutes ago
Senior Fullstack Developer for AI-Driven Mission Technologies
Seeking a Senior Fullstack Developer for AI-driven mission technologies, focusing on Java, JavaScript, Python, and C++. Remote work available.
Senior Full-Stack Engineer ReactJS/NodeJS
Join Gorgias as a Senior Full-Stack Engineer specializing in ReactJS and NodeJS, enhancing AI-powered ecommerce solutions.
Software Engineer - Cloud Applications and Python
Join Topicus as a Software Engineer in Arnhem to develop cloud applications using Python, REST APIs, and ETL processes for healthcare data services.
Senior Java/VueJS Developer
Join Space Inch as a Senior Java/VueJS Developer to work on fintech projects with a focus on Java, Vue.js, and TypeScript in a flexible remote environment.
Senior Backend Engineer with Python and React.js
Join bunq as a Senior Backend Engineer to revolutionize digital banking with Python and React.js in a hybrid work environment.
Full Stack Engineer with Node.js and React
Join RightCrowd as a Full Stack Engineer to develop cloud-native applications using Node.js and React. Work remotely with cutting-edge technology.
Remote FullStack Developer (m/w/d)
Join our dynamic IT company as a Remote FullStack Developer, working with JavaScript, Node.js, and Python. Flexible hours and remote work.
Full Stack Developer with AI and API Expertise
Join Catalyze Group as a Full Stack Developer to build AI-powered grant-writing tools. Work with React, Django, and more in Amsterdam.
Senior Software Engineer - Microservices and Python
Join Bloomreach as a Senior Software Engineer to work on microservices and Python in a remote-first environment.
Senior Python Developer with AWS Experience
Join Basetime BV as a Senior Python Developer to develop and maintain AWS cloud solutions. Hybrid work, competitive salary, and growth opportunities.
Backend Software Engineer - Privacy Technology
Join Zalando as a Backend Software Engineer in Privacy Technology, focusing on data protection and privacy automation services.
Staff Software Engineer
Join Aiven as a Staff Software Engineer to develop cloud operations platforms using open-source technologies. Hybrid work in Berlin.
Lead Developer with DevOps and Functional Programming
Join Reaktor as a Lead Developer in Amsterdam, focusing on DevOps, Functional Programming, and JavaScript in a hybrid work environment.
Senior Backend Engineer - Payments
Join Instapro Group as a Senior Backend Engineer in Berlin, focusing on PHP and payment systems in a hybrid work environment.
Software Engineer II - Developer Experience
Join Elastic as a Software Engineer II in Developer Experience, focusing on test frameworks for Kibana. Remote work, competitive benefits.
Fullstack Developer (C#, Angular or React)
Join Lekker Code Company as a Fullstack Developer specializing in C#, Angular, or React. Work remotely with a focus on innovative solutions.
Senior Backend Engineer - PHP, Symfony, Laravel
Join Instapro Group as a Senior Backend Engineer, working with PHP, Symfony, and Laravel in a hybrid environment.
Senior Software Engineer - Python, Apache Kafka
Join Aiven as a Senior Software Engineer in Berlin, focusing on Python and Apache Kafka in a hybrid work environment.
Senior Software Engineer - AWS, Python, Ruby on Rails
Join HeyJobs as a Senior Software Engineer to design scalable systems using AWS, Python, and Ruby on Rails in a dynamic team.
Cloud Data Engineer
Seeking a Cloud Data Engineer with expertise in AWS, Python, and CI/CD for a hybrid role in Hannover. Join our dynamic team!
Full-Stack Developer with React.js and Azure Experience
Join Elma Schmidbauer GmbH as a Full-Stack Developer to enhance Azure-based web infrastructure using React.js and Next.js.
Senior Software Engineer - Python, Django, Angular
Join Ilkari as a Senior Software Engineer to lead development in Python, Django, and Angular, creating scalable solutions in a hybrid work environment.
Senior Full Stack Engineer (PHP, Angular, React)
Seeking a Senior Full Stack Engineer with PHP, Angular, React expertise for remote work in the EU. 6+ years experience required.
LLM Backend Developer
Join Persona as a LLM Backend Developer, work remotely, and develop AI-driven backend systems for top startups.